Georgia residents are fighting efforts to build a massive monkey-breeding facility in their city
A plan to build a massive monkey-breeding facility that could eventually house 30,000 long-tailed macaques in a small Georgia city has sparked a multipronged legal battle pitting residents against a company whose executives have faced scrutiny for their past …
Read More
Reviews
0 %